This first card was created using the Day of Gratitude set and the Autumn Spice designer paper. The base layer is Cajun Craze embossed with the Vintage Wallpaper embossing folder and a piece of the Autumn Spice DSP at the bottom.. then Old Olive and More Mustard cardstock were used for the medallion piece which was layered over Early Espresso Satin ribbon and then finished off with a Cajun Craze button tied off with linen thread. You have the option to sponge the cardstock if you like.. I used Cajun Craze over  the embossed piece and around the bottom layer of Autumn Spice, Early Espresso on the Old Olive piece and More Mustard around the top layer of the medallion ... and there you go!


This is another Fall card created using the Day of Gratitude set.. Love it!! We used the Scallop hand punch and the NEW Sizzix Die called Scallop Squares Duo getting that nice scallop layer effect! You'll use More Mustard as the card base, a piece of Early Espresso as the base layer adding a layer of Cajun Craze which you run through the Bis shot with the Square Lattice embossing folder.. I just love this folder and the dimension you get! To create the scallop squares you'll need Old Olive and More Mustard cardstock using the hand scallop punch and then the Autumn Spice designer paper with the Sizzix Die Scallop Squares Duo (found in the Holiday Mini). The card was finished off with a piece of Early Espresso Satin ribbon tied off in a knot.


With this card you will need a base layer of Old Olive cardstock and the Perfect Polka Dots embossing folder.. run it through the Big Shot to get that nice dimension, wrap a piece of Early Espresso satin ribbon around the card front and tie off in a knot .. for the Medallion you will need a piece of Early Espresso and Cajun Craze (running the cajun craze through the big shot with the square lattice embossing folder).. grab your scallop hand punch and punch 4 squares out of the Autumn Spice designer paper, layer and adhere them onto the Cajun Craze.. stamp the sentiment from the Day of Gratitude set onto a piece of More Mustard cardstock and then punch it out using the NEW Decorative Label punch found in the Mini...sponge around it with More Mustard and layer it with stampin' dimensionals then place stampin dimensionals on the back of the Medallion, place that over the ribbon and your done!
